With the growing demand for eco-robotics in various industries, this course offers a timely and valuable learning opportunity. Throughout the course, learners will gain hands-on experience in designing, building, and programming eco-robots for various applications such as wildlife monitoring, habitat restoration, and pollution control. They will also learn about the ethical considerations and regulations surrounding the use of robotics in conservation. Upon completion, learners will be prepared to enter or advance in the eco-robotics industry, where they can make a positive impact on the environment. This course not only provides technical skills but also fosters creativity, critical thinking, and problem-solving abilities, making learners highly sought after in various fields.
